When is the Best Time to Visit the Maldives?

The Maldives enjoys warm, tropical weather year-round, but it experiences two distinct seasons: the dry season and the wet monsoon season.

Peak Season (November to April): This is the best time to visit the Maldives for perfect blue skies, calm waters, and maximum sunshine. Expect higher prices for flights and accommodations.

Shoulder Season (May and October): You will encounter unpredictable weather and occasional rainstorms, but resorts offer massive discounts. It is also the absolute best time for surfing and manta ray spotting.

Low Season (June to September): The peak of the wet season. If you don't mind brief daily downpours, you can score luxury overwater villas for a fraction of their usual price.

Top Things to Do in the Maldives

​While doing absolutely nothing on the beach is highly recommended, the Maldives offers incredible adventures for thrill-seekers and nature lovers alike.

1. Snorkel or Dive with Whale Sharks and Manta Rays

​The Maldives is home to some of the richest marine biodiversity on the planet. Head to South Ari Atoll for year-round whale shark sightings, or visit Hanifaru Bay (a UNESCO Biosphere Reserve) between May and November to swim alongside hundreds of feeding manta rays.

​2. Stay in an Overwater Bungalow

​It’s the quintessential Maldivian experience. Waking up to the sound of the ocean and jumping straight from your private deck into a natural aquarium is worth the splurge for at least a night or two.

​3. Experience a Sandbank Picnic
​Many resorts and local guesthouses offer excursions to completely deserted sandbanks. Imagine sitting in the middle of the ocean on a tiny patch of pristine sand with nothing but a shade umbrella and a picnic basket.

​Maldives Travel Tips: What You Need to Know Before You Go

​Getting Around: You will arrive at Velana International Airport (MLE) in Malé. From there, you will need to take either a speedboat (for closer islands) or a seaplane (for distant resorts) to reach your final destination. Note that seaplanes only fly during daylight hours.

Currency & Tipping: The local currency is the Maldivian Rufiyaa (MVR), but US Dollars and credit cards are widely accepted everywhere. Tipping isn't strictly mandatory as a 10% service charge is usually added to bills, but it is highly appreciated by the hardworking island staff.

Cultural Respect: The Maldives is a conservative Muslim country. If you are staying on or visiting a local island, ensure you dress modestly (covering shoulders and knees) outside of designated tourist beach zones.
